A sociology-cultural group, Net-zit Patriotic Front, has deemed Governor Nasir El-Rufai of Kaduna State “mentally imbalance and unfit” to run the state.

The group’s assertion follows the claim by Governor El-Rufai that he had paid money to Fulani herdsmen to end the killings of Christians in Southern Kaduna.

While expressing disappointment in the governor’s claim, the group said that El-Rufai has clearly shown how numb and incapable he is to govern the state.

In a statement signed by one George Makeri, the group called for El-Rufai’s immediate resignation, adding that the governor must be arrested and prosecuted by the international police for “crimes against humanity.”

“Governor El-Rufai had during an interview said he sent a delegation to other countries to pay Fulani Herdsmen to ‘stop’ the killings in the Southern part of Kaduna state,” Makeri.

“It is observed that each time the governor visited Southern Kaduna community in the aftermath of an attack, a more vicious one is launched the following day in another peaceful community.

“Given the above, we have come to the sad conclusion that the Kaduna State governor is mentally imbalance and unfit to continue as Governor of Kaduna State. He needs to vacate Kashim Ibrahim House immediately if sanity must return to the state. We hope the international police will quickly pick him up to be prosecuted for crimes against humanity.”

“These atrocities were coupled with the complete terrorism on all neighbouring communities from Godogodo, Golkofa, Angwan Anjo, Pasakori, with Gidan Waya recently joining the long list of assaulted villages and Kafanchan presently tensed up.

“Chawai in Kauru local government area is not spared too as many people were massacred and many others displaced in an assault conducted a day after the governor erected a public apology bill board at the Samuru Kataf round about. As we write, thousands have been massacred and thousands more have been displaced.

“It is curious and unfortunate to note that the intensity and quick spread of these fulani-instigated violence across the length and breadth of southern Kaduna could be traced to the Kaduna State Governor’s body language that urges the fulani murderers on while intimidating and victimising the victims some more because the victims were non-muslims nor Hausa fulani like him, even against his oath of office,” he said.
